Description

This volume of the 5 Questions series is devoted to philosophical practice. Philosophical practice is rooted in the Greek understanding of philosophy as linked to the actual experience of man. It places the philosopher in real life armed with a Socratic state of mind that facilitates critical, comprehensive and creative thinking. Interviews with Lydia Amir, José Barrientos-Rastrojo, Dries Boele, Vaughana Macy Feary, Fred Gebler, Horst Gronke, Finn Thorbjørn Hansen, Leon de Haas, Henning Herrestad, Jos Kessels, Dieter Krohn, Ran Lahav, Anders Lindseth, Lou Marinoff, Peter Raabe, Shlomit Schuster, Helge Svare
